Synthesis of Water Soluble Graphene

Nano Letters · 2008 · Vol. 8(6) · pp. 1679–1682
Yongchao SiEdward T. Samulski

Abstract

A facile and scalable preparation of aqueous solutions of isolated, sparingly sulfonated graphene is reported. (13)C NMR and FTIR spectra indicate that the bulk of the oxygen-containing functional groups was removed from graphene oxide. The electrical conductivity of thin evaporated films of graphene (1250 S/m) relative to similarly prepared graphite (6120 S/m) implies that an extended conjugated sp (2) network is restored in the water soluble graphene.
